Interactive whiteboards allow teachers to write on a screen while simultaneously projecting it into the room. This gives teachers the ability to present their lessons on a larger scale while also allowing students to see what is being taught. This also allows students to be more actively involved in their own learning because they can interact with the lesson as it is presented.

For example, if a teacher is reviewing a math problem and there are multiple steps involved, an interactive whiteboard can be used to walk students through each step of solving the problem. Students can see how each step fits into solving a more significant problem and how it will affect them individually.

Another way to use interactive whiteboards is to allow students to be more actively involved in their learning and manipulate what is displayed on the whiteboard. Smart interactive whiteboards allow teachers to provide students with questions on an interactive quiz that the teacher has already created. Students can read questions off the screen and answer them using either a computer or construction paper placed over a light sensor.
